Launch notes
The flat ocean water allows easy beach launches from sandy areas. NW, ENE, and E wind directions are most favorable; avoid launching during weak S and SSW flows when wind becomes marginal.
Gear & clothing
Gear · Pack a 17m and 14m kite to handle the light 8.5kt average wind; a 12m provides backup for stronger days. Use a directional board or twin-tip suited for flat water progression and light wind performance.
Clothing · A 3/2mm wetsuit works year-round for North Florida's mild winters; switch to 2/2mm or rashguard during warmer months (Jun, Oct). Water temperatures range from 65-82°F depending on season.

Additional notes
Best months (Jan, Mar, Oct, Nov) offer more consistent wind than summer; check local thermal patterns as afternoon sea breeze development can improve marginal morning sessions. Only 32 windy days annually means flexibility and patience are essential.
